according to on-chain analyst Yu Jin's monitoring, the current costs and profit and loss status of several institutions are as follows:
Strategy: The current BTC price has dropped close to Strategy's cost line: it holds 712,600 BTC with an average cost price of $76,037. The unrealized gains have basically been fully reversed, and if it falls another $3,000, it will officially be "underwater."
Tom Lee's Bitmine: Holds 4,243,000 ETH with an average cost price of $3,849. Bitmine has been "underwater" all along, but as ETH has now dropped to $2,400, the unrealized loss has hit a new high, reaching $5.92 billion. The loss has exceeded one-third (-36%).
Yi Lihua's Trend Research: Holds 651,500 ETH with an average cost price of about $3,180, currently with an unrealized loss of $475 million. Because leverage was added through borrowing, these ETH positions have a liquidation price around $1,880, about $570 away from the current price.
